I guess we all know that Danielle Steel is not one of the best authors around, a lot of her books are very cheesy, not very original and predictable, but she also wrote a few nice ones. This is not one of my favorites, but it's a nice and easy read and I like ballerinas and a good love story. My actual rating is 3,5 stars.After Danina's death her grand-daughter discovers that her grand-mother was once a very talented young ballet dancer who fell in love with the much older and married Nicolaj who was one of the private doctors of the Romanov (royal) family. Danina and Nicolaj fight for their love and just when it seems that they have overcome all obstacles, the revolution strikes and everybody who has a connection with the Romanov family is in danger. They have to go seperate ways with the promise of a mutual future in the United States of America.I loved to read about Danina's life as a ballet dancer, she is a very realistic and likable character and her love story with Nicolaj was sweet and interesting enough to keep me entertained and reading.Lesson learned: Old people were once young too and have a story to tell. I wish I had had the chance to talk with my grand-parents about the time that they were young.

Granny Dan had been a ballet star in Russia.She lost her mother at a young age. Her dad was in the army along with her 4 brothers. Her dad had no idea what to do with a little girl. After 2 years of having someone take care of her, he took her to Madame Markova's where she would learn ballet.She learned to dance and pushed herself very hard to make Madame Markova proud of her.She became sick with the flu. She had been asked by the czar to come to a house on their property and recover. This is where she fell in love with Nikolai. He was the doctor taking care of her.She went back to dance, working harder than she had before she became sick. Eventually, she fell and broke her ankle. She was unable to dance anymore.Nikolai talked her into going to Vermont to stay with his cousin until he could get there. This cousin was Granny Dan's husband. She had put in a box her ballet shoes, her locket with Nikolai's picture, and her letters. This box was sent from the nursing home.

This was a sweet short story about a young woman who loses her grandma. She had a close relationship with her grandma but she finds out things she never knew about her. After her grandmother dies, the nursing home gives the young woman a box of mementos that were in the closet. In this box she finds ballet slippers, and live notes tied in a bundle along with other special trinkets and mementos. As she reads these letters she discovers that grandma was once a well known ballerina in Moscow and that she once was in love with someone else other than her grandfather. She never thought of grandma as once being young and in love she just always thought of her being old and only with grandpa. This story has many peaks and valleys. Just when you think there will be a happily ever after something else happens. Just as it happens in real life, things don't stay easy or good for long, something always comes along to mess it up. You have to take the bad with the good and move forward.A very nice heartwarming story to remind us all that grandma and grandpa were once young as well. They did the same things we did as kids or young adults even though it is hard to imagine.
